Abstract

As three-dimensional (3D) printing and additive manufacturing becomes a way for individuals and companies to distribute physical goods, there is a growing need for creators of physical goods to enable customers to customize 3D printed objects while protecting core electronic assets in the form of the files used to define and print the objects. Server-side rendering of 3D object images provides an opportunity to protect 3D object files while offering performance advantages. A scripting language may be central to delivering a seamless user experience interacting with 3D object models on client devices. Object creators and vendors may rely on the scripting language to create user interfaces for selling customizable objects. And once the user interface is developed, it may provide the basis for users accessing, viewing, manipulating, selecting materials, rendering, pricing, and printing a range of 3D objects.

Claims (64)

1 . A computer implemented method comprising acts of:

displaying to a user interacting with the display of a client computer in a distributed computer system, a first presentation interface including a first display interface and a first control interface,

wherein 1) the first display interface is configured to display an image relating to a computer representation of a three-dimensional object, 2) the computer representation of the three-dimensional object comprises at least one script and a set of parameter values, and 3) the first control interface is configured to accept at least one or more first inputs comprising the group of: scripts, parameter ranges, initial parameter values, material selections, and object identifiers;

receiving at a server, from the user interacting with the presentation interface, the one or more first inputs;

generating, by the server, an image relating to the computer representation of the three-dimensional object responsive to the one or more first inputs;

displaying, by the server, the image within the first presentation interface;

receiving, from the user, a request to generate a second presentation interface including a second display interface configured to display an image relating to a computer representation of the three-dimensional object and a second control interface configured to accept at least one or more second inputs capable of modifying parameters associated with the three-dimensional object

generating, by the server, the second presentation interface; and

displaying, by the server, the second presentation interface.
